2006 Mercury Mountaineer vs. 1989 Nissan Santana
To start off, 2006 Mercury Mountaineer is newer by 17 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1989 Nissan Santana.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1989 Nissan Santana would be higher. At 4,605 cc (8 cylinders), 2006 Mercury Mountaineer is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Mercury Mountaineer (293 HP @ 5750 RPM) has 200 more horse power than 1989 Nissan Santana. (93 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Mercury Mountaineer should accelerate faster than 1989 Nissan Santana.
Let's talk about torque, 2006 Mercury Mountaineer (407 Nm @ 4750 RPM) has 265 more torque (in Nm) than 1989 Nissan Santana. (142 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2006 Mercury Mountaineer will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1989 Nissan Santana.
Compare all specifications:
2006 Mercury Mountaineer | 1989 Nissan Santana | |
Make | Mercury | Nissan |
Model | Mountaineer | Santana |
Year Released | 2006 | 1989 |
Engine Size | 4605 cc | 1781 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Horse Power | 293 HP | 93 HP |
Engine RPM | 5750 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 407 Nm | 142 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4750 RPM | 3600 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Vehicle Length | 4920 mm | 4550 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1870 mm | 1700 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1860 mm | 1400 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2890 mm | 2560 mm |
